  1. Assist physicians during diagnostic and interventional procedures in the Cardiac Catheterization Laboratory.
  2. Utilize state-of-the-art technology and equipment to ensure accurate and high-quality images.
  3. Provide exceptional and compassionate patient care in a fast-paced and dynamic environment.
  4. Maintain a safe and clean work environment, adhering to all safety protocols and procedures.
  5. Collaborate with interdisciplinary team members to ensure efficient and effective patient care.
  6. Monitor patient vital signs and report any changes or concerns to the medical team.
  7. Maintain accurate and detailed patient records, documenting all procedures and interventions.
  8. Troubleshoot equipment issues and report any malfunctions to the appropriate personnel.
  9. Stay updated on the latest advancements in cath lab technology and techniques.
  10. Adhere to all hospital policies, procedures, and regulations.
  11. Participate in on-call duties as needed.
  12. Foster a positive and professional work environment.
  13. Attend and actively participate in staff meetings and trainings.
  14. Provide guidance and support to less experienced technologists as needed.
  15. Uphold Mayo Clinic's mission and values while representing the organization with integrity and professionalism.

Job Qualifications
  • Current Certification By The American Registry Of Radiologic Technologists (Arrt) In Radiography.

  • Bachelor's Degree In Radiologic Technology Or Equivalent Education And Experience.

  • Minimum Of 2 Years Experience In A Cardiac Catheterization Lab Setting.

  • Proficient In Operating And Troubleshooting Various Cath Lab Equipment, Including Digital Imaging Systems And Hemodynamic Monitoring Devices.

  • Excellent Communication And Interpersonal Skills, With The Ability To Work Effectively In A Team Environment And Provide Compassionate Care To Patients.

About Mayo Clinic

The Mayo Clinic is an American not-for-profit organization academic medical center based in Rochester, Minnesota, focused on integrated clinical practice, education, and research. It employs over 4,500 physicians and scientists, along with another 58,400 administrative and allied health staff.
